Hi Tomas,

Welcome to the on-call rotation! Quick heads-up before Thursday's eng sync: the encoding detector in Driftbin has been flaky with uploaded text files lately. It guesses Latin-1 for short UTF-8 files with no BOM, and users see garbled characters. We've got a heuristic patch in review, but until it lands you may get pages about it — just requeue the file with the encoding override flag. The override steps and detector internals are written up on the page below.

wiki page, bagaf-fawip: https://harbor.tolvaqsys.local/pages/repo/pages/secrets/eac969ffc71f356b

Subject: FY Training Budget — Decision Needed

Team,

Proposed training budget for next year is flat versus this year, reallocated toward the Hollis certification track and away from general workshops. Delverow branch gets a one-off uplift for the new systems rollout. Finance needs sign-off by Friday. Rationale tied to broader plans is noted below.

internal memo for kawip-hadug: Headcount on the Wenwyn team goes from 7 to 140 by the end of January. Gross margin on Wenwyn came in at 20 percent against a plan of 15 percent.

Runbook: locale extraction script

The extractor (ling-sweep) walks the Bramblewick monorepo nightly, pulls tagged strings, and writes catalogs to the locale bucket. Idempotent; safe to re-run. Failures are almost always bad format specifiers — check the lint report first. Never hand-edit generated catalogs; fix the source string and re-run. Partial runs leave a lock file; delete it only after confirming no job is active. Merge conflicts in catalogs mean two branches tagged the same key. Runtime behavior is governed by the values below.

deployment values, fahap-hahaf:
[casdor]
port = 9200
region = south-2
host = casdor.qirvanworks.corp
timeout_ms = 3000
retries = 4

## Authentication

The Tallyfern loyalty-points ledger exposes a single internal endpoint for credits, debits, and reconciliation snapshots. All writes are idempotent and keyed by transaction token. Maintainers should note that the ledger rejects any request lacking a valid service credential, and rotation happens quarterly via the Mossbridge vault job. For local integration testing against the staging ledger, authenticate with the key below.

gateway credential: kto23_LX9A4ys6i4nzHtpOLNLodKK